Fertilizing is fundamental to supporting plant health and achieving lush, lively landscapes. Plants need a well balanced supply of nutrients-- mostly n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ium-- to grow strong roots, produce plentiful blossoms, and maintain vibrant foliage. A soil test is the first step in identifying what nutrients are lacking, ensuring that the picked fertilizer fulfills the particular needs of the site. Fertilizers come in numerous forms, including granular, liquid, organic, and artificial, each using various release rates and advantages. Using the best type at the right time is important to prevent nutrient overflow, root burn, or unequal growth. Seasonal timing, such as applying higher nitrogen in the spring and more potassium in the fall, helps plants prepare for growth spurts or hold up against winter stress. Consistent fertilization not just improves plant look but also enhances resilience against insects, illness, and environmental stress factors. A well-fed landscape is more likely to flourish year after year, offering both beauty and ecological value
